What is Annatto Oil?

Annatto oil is a golden-red, infused oil made from achiote seeds (from the annatto tree), known for their natural color and subtle earthy flavor. Used widely in Latin American and Caribbean cuisines, it adds warmth and depth to dishes without overpowering them.

How do I use annatto oil in cooking?

It’s incredibly versatile! You can:

  • Sauté vegetables, onions, or garlic
  • Use it as a base for rice, beans, or stews
  • Drizzle it over roasted veggies or grilled meats
  • Add it to marinades or dressings for color and depth

Where does Annatto come from?

Annatto seeds come from the achiote tree native to Latin America. The seeds have been used for centuries in traditional cooking, natural dyeing, and even ceremonial body paint.

Is annatto oil spicy or hot?

Not at all! Annatto adds a vibrant golden color and mild flavor—not heat. It’s perfect for those who want depth of flavor without spice.

What does annatto oil taste like?

Annatto oil has a mild and nutty flavor with hints of earthiness. It’s not spicy and won’t dominate a dish—think of it as an elegant flavor enhancer.

Does Annatto oil stain cookware or clothing?

Annatto’s natural pigment is vibrant, so it may stain light fabrics or porous materials. We recommend using it carefully and cleaning up any spills promptly.
